Walk Together takes place on Saturday 25 October.
In cities and regional centres all over Australia, you’re invited to join this celebration of diversity and present a picture to our leaders and media of the Australia that is possible. An Australia that recognises in its public debate, media conversation and legislation that we are all common people with common dreams. Equally deserving of freedom, fairness, opportunity to contribute, welcome and belonging.
We are common people with common dreams.
We believe Australians are a welcoming, generous and compassionate people. We believe an Australia where prejudice is unpopular and cruelty hurts at the polls, is possible. An Australia that recognises the equality and dignity of all people - no matter who you are, where you’re from or how you arrived here – and extends our values of fairness and friendship to everyone. We dream of a nation that celebrates diversity, made up of communities where people of our First Nations, asylum seekers, refugees, international students, skilled migrants and every other human being can experience the joy and security of belonging.
